What's The Definition Of Prosiness?

[n] commonplaceness as a consequence of being humdrum and not exciting

Synonyms | Synonyms for Prosiness: prosaicness

Prosiness In Webster's Dictionary

\Pros"i*ness\, n. The quality or state of being prosy; tediousness; tiresomeness.
